One assistant with key ties to the B1G is reportedly the top target to replace Jamey Chadwell as the next head coach at Coastal Carolina.
The coaching carousel has reshuffled a number of jobs with Hugh Freeze departing Liberty for Auburn. Chadwell has since accepted the vacancy at Liberty, opening up the spot at Coastal Carolina.
According to ESPN’s Adam Rittenberg, Coastal is targeting current NC State OC Tim Beck for the head coaching job. Beck has been with the Wolfpack since 2020 but has ties that stretch back to the B1G.
With Jamey Chadwell off to Liberty, Coastal Carolina is targeting NC State offensive coordinator Tim Beck as its next coach, sources tell ESPN. A deal is not finalized yet. Beck also has been OC at Texas, Ohio State and Nebraska.

Beck served on Bo Pelini’s staff at Nebraska from 2008-14, including serving in the role of OC from 2011-14. After that, Beck served on Urban Meyer’s Ohio State staff as Co-OC and QB coach from 2015-16.
Beck eventually transitioned to Texas as a part of Tom Herman’s staff from 2017-19.
